With CWS comeback, Louisville does something no ACC school has done in 2 years.

Louisville’s comeback victory Sunday over Arizona kept alive the Cardinal’s chance at a national title. Arizona is the first team eliminated, as Louisville down 3-2 in the bottom of the 8th scored 6 runs and won 8-3.

Quietly, Louisville did something no ACC school has done in nearly 2 years. When was the last time an ACC school won a CFP playoff game, Final 4 game, men’s or women’s, a CWS games, or College Softball Word Series game? You have to go back a year ago when Florida State beat UNC 8-4 in the CWS.

When was the last time an ACC school beat somebody from outside the ACC in one of those events?

We’re back in 2023 when Wake Forest beat LSU 3-2.

Now, Louisville has pulled the trick with the victory Sunday. Good for them, and ACC commissioner Jim Phillips breathes a sigh of relief.
